Overview

VN5E050MJTR-E from STMicroelectronics is a single-channel automotive high-side driver in PowerSSO-12 package, integrating analog current sense, power-limiting overload protection, and 3.0 V/5.0 V CMOS-compatible control. It delivers 27 A typical current limit, 50 mΩ on-state resistance at 25°C, and operates from 4.5 V to 28 V supply for 12 V grounded loads such as LED headlamps and solenoid valves.

Technical Context

The device implements active power limitation during inrush and overload via dynamic RON modulation, with thermal shutdown at 150°C and auto-restart at 135°C hysteresis. Its VIPower™ M0-5 process enables integrated overvoltage clamp (41–52 V), undervoltage lockout (4.5 V ±0.5 V), and reverse-battery tolerance via external GND network.

Current sensing uses a proportional analog output (K0 = 1170–3090 A/A) referenced to VSENSE, with <40 µs delay between IOUT rise and ISENSE response. The CS_DIS pin disables sensing with 5–100 µs enable/disable latency, enabling shared external sense resistor topologies.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Max supply voltage 41 V - withstands load-dump transients per ISO 7637-2 without external clamp
Operating voltage range 4.5 V to 28 V - supports cold-crank (4.5 V) and boosted battery (28 V) automotive conditions
On-state resistance 50 mΩ at 25°C - limits conduction loss to ≤260 mW at 2.3 A continuous load
Current limit (typ) 27 A - sustains short-circuit for >100 ms before thermal shutdown triggers
Standby current 2 µA - enables low-power always-on modules without battery drain
Current sense ratio 1575–2000 A/A at 1 A - enables ±5% load current measurement accuracy with 3.9 kΩ external resistor
Thermal shutdown 150°C with 15°C hysteresis - ensures safe recovery after transient overloads without manual reset

Pinout & Package

Package: PowerSSO-12 - thermally enhanced exposed-tab SOIC variant with 12 terminals, optimized for PCB copper area heat spreading (Rthj-amb = 25°C/W with 10 cm² copper).

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
VCC Battery supply input Accepts 4.5–28 V DC; clamped to 41–52 V during transients; connects to exposed tab for thermal path
OUT High-side switched output Drives grounded loads; features VON limitation (25 mV) for open-load detection
GND Ground reference Must be reverse-battery protected externally (diode/resistor network per Figure 29)
IN CMOS-compatible control input Hysteresis (0.25 V) prevents noise-induced switching; logic-high ≥2.1 V enables output
CS Analog current sense output Sinks proportional current (ISENSE = IOUT/K); max 5 V output for 4 A load
CS_DIS Current sense disable control Active-high CMOS input; disables CS pin when ≥2.1 V, enabling multi-device sense sharing

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Inrush current management Active power limitation prevents fuse blow during capacitive load turn-on
Proportional analog current sense ±10% full-scale accuracy across –40°C to 150°C with <40 µs response latency
Reverse battery protection support Internal ESD-hardened structure allows external diode/resistor GND network (Figure 29)
Overtemperature auto-restart Shuts down at 150°C, recovers at 135°C - avoids system latch-up during intermittent faults
Load dump immunity Withstands 41 V clamping and 104 mJ demagnetization energy (L = 3 mH, Vbat = 13.5 V)

FAQ

What is the maximum continuous output current supported by VN5E050MJTR-E?

The device does not specify a continuous current rating; instead, it uses active power limitation to sustain 27 A short-circuit current for ~100 ms before thermal shutdown. Continuous operation depends on PCB thermal design: with 10 cm² copper, it supports ≥5 A at 85°C ambient per Rthj-amb = 25°C/W and PD = (Tjmax − Tamb)/Rthj-amb.

How does the CS_DIS pin affect current sense functionality?

When CS_DIS is pulled high (>2.1 V), the internal current sense amplifier disconnects from the CS pin, forcing ISENSE ≈ 0 µA. This allows multiple VN5E050MJTR-E devices to share a single external sense resistor, reducing system-level component count and improving measurement consistency across channels.

Can VN5E050MJTR-E drive inductive loads without external flyback protection?

Yes - the integrated overvoltage clamp (41–52 V) and 104 mJ demagnetization energy rating allow direct driving of solenoids and relays up to 3 mH inductance at 13.5 V supply. External TVS diodes are unnecessary unless peak transients exceed 52 V or energy exceeds 104 mJ.

What is the recommended layout practice for thermal performance?

Connect the exposed PowerSSO-12 tab directly to a ≥10 cm² internal or external copper plane using ≥6 thermal vias (0.3 mm diameter). Maintain ≥0.5 mm clearance from other components on the tab side, and avoid solder mask over the tab area to maximize heat transfer to the PCB.
